#3fc643 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fc643 is composed of 24.7% red, 77.6%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#3fc643 color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ff86 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3fc643 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fc643 has RGB values of R:63, G:198,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 4179523.

Shades and Tints of #3fc643
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fc643
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828382 is the less saturated color, while #0ff616 is the most saturated one.
